Can Bridge manage images?

I'm looking for a software that will manage over 300 to 700 gigabyte of images. Some of the file type are as follows:
jpg,
jpeg
gif
png
ai
eps
psd
tiff
Will Adobe Bridge be able to manage? I want the software to be able to search the whole 300-700GB base on file name, metadata, or date. If Adobe Bridge can't do it, what are some of the best software that will be able to handel this?
Many thanks in advance.

Bridge can do what you want, but can it do it the way you want is the question.  For it to find something the files have to be indxed, and for some systems this becomes a problem, especially on folders visited infrequently.  Problems can also arise with files on a network or external drive, or across different drives (not possible)..
Do you have Bridge now?  Does it work for you?  Since Bridge is not a standalone product it would be expensive to buy Photoshop just to do searches.
Vista can also search for files, and is quite fast if you have your files indxed with the MS system.  There are also other browsers like Picasa that might work.
So depends on what you have and how you will be using it.

  • Can Bridge label images in Finder?

    I want the images I've selected in Bridge  - sorted by Rating -  to have a color label when I view them in a folder in Finder. Currently I just manually label each one in Finder with the Bridge window open. is there a better way?

    Label colors are very seldom interacting with other applications, Finder is not compatible with Bridge and v.v.
    If you do want to color label the files in Finder the quickest way in my opinion would be to create separate folders for this temporarily job. For instance create 5 folders, 1 folder per rating. Set those folders in the favorite panel and be sure to have them in sight.
    Use the folder panel preferable under the favorite panel, you can move panels with drag and drop to create your own workspace in Bridge.
    In the folder panel select the folder you have the rated files in. Then use the filter panel (again placed visible, move to desired place, you can have all three in one column e.g. at the left, next to content panel) and select 1 star to only view the 1 star rating in content panel.
    Now select all in content panel and drag and drop the files to the 1 star rating folder in favorites.
    Then switch to Finder and point to the 1 star rating folder. Again use select all and with right mouse click menu select the color label you want to apply, let go and all selected files are applied with the color label.
    Go back to Bridge and select the 1 star folder in favorites, drag and drop the files back to their original folder and repeat this method for other ratings using filter panel and drag and drop.
    It is a bit of a D-tour but much faster then using the one by one method…

  • GPS Metadata for Managed Images Bug

    Alright this is really dumb. Aperture strips the GPS metadata for managed images on a version export, but does not for referenced files.
    It just took me 4 hours to figure that out, ug. Metadata is sacred! Always preserve it.

    My Aperture library uses managed masters.
    I too discovered that if I performed *version exports* of geotagged masters the exported images did not retain the GPS data. The problem was the same regardless of whether the masters were .jpgs or RAW files. (Geotagging was performed with Maperture and Maperture Pro; the bug symptoms are the same regardless of which tool was used.)
    Additionally, I discovered that if I performed *master exports*, then not only were the geotags retained in the exported files, but that +reimporting those same exports resulted in new masters whose versions would subsequently retain their geotags on version export+.
    synonym wrote:
    If you Relocate Masters... BEFORE you add GPS metadata using Maperture you don't lose any IPTC metadata. If you then Consolidate Masters... you can then apply GPS metadata to these images within your Aperture library and you will not lose IPTC or the GPS data on exporting the versions.
    If I'm reading this correctly it sounds like you can "scrub" your library of the problem by relocating masters and then consolidating them again, and that subsequently applied geotags (and by inference IPTC metadata) will be retained on new version exports. Did I get that right?
    However if you already have loads of images in your Aperture library that you have added GPS data to with Maperture and you also have loads of IPTC metadata on them and adjustments what do you do?
    I did a backup of the library at this point to a vault. I then restored the vault and GPS data and IPTC metadata was all retained and was also all retained on exporting versions!
    And if I'm reading the last sentence of your post correctly, it seems like the consistent behavior between our two situations is that if *images are brought into the library with geotags already in them* - in your case by library restoration and in my case by re-importation of previously geotagged masters - *then the geotags will be retained on subsequent master and version exports*.
    Is that a valid conclusion to draw? If so, it sounds like I could workaround the problem of geotags missing from my version exports by either A) relocating and then consolidating my masters, or B) by the three-step process of:
    1) geotagging my images,
    2) updating the vault, and then
    3) restoring my library from the vault.

  • Managed image not found

    I was doing a relocate originals to get the masters out of my vault and into a backed up system.   After it was "done", there is one file that says "image not found".  However, I can find the image file.  How can I get Aperture to not see it as a managed image (that isn't in its vault) and instead to be a referenced image where I can point it to the file?
    Thanks in advance,
    Alan
    Aperture 3.4.4

    leonieDF wrote:
    The message in the vault panel can be misleading. It will also count files in the Photo Stream. Are you using Photo Stream?
    If Aperture relocated your images, you will be able to use the command "File > Show in Finder". Try that on some files in the project in question. If aperture still has the file indexed as "managed", the Show in Finder should be grayed out.
    If your files are truely managed, you will see them in the Library package. Ctrl-click the Aperture library and use the command "Show Package Contents". Open the folder "Masters" and navigate to the subfolder of the date, when you imported the project. Managed originals should be stored there.
    Regards
    Léonie
    Ah-ha! Yes, it's PhotoStream well, 155 of them are. The reast are in various sub-folders under Masters but they aren't the master files (those are definitely disk outside of the Library) and they are very small - <100k and the ones I've looked at are 720x540 whereas the originals were either 2048x1536 (iPhone 4S) or 3888x2592 (CanonEOS400D) so I don't know where they've come from The only clue is that the pixel size is the size of Std Def TV (UK PAL).
    I take it that PhotoStream images are Managed and can't be Referenced? Any idea where the others may have come from? I take it that it wouldn't be wise to go deleting them!!
